BEIJING, Feb. 28 -- Minister of Civil Affairs Li Liguo on Friday demanded better supervision of social assistance funds to ensure the money ends up with those who need it most.
A social assistance regulation to minimize the difference in assistance and subsidies between urban and rural areas will come into effect on May 1.
The regulation is the first to coordinate and regulate the fragmented social assistance system.
Civil affairs offices must tighten management and accountability system to make sure the cash is used for its intended purpose: social relief, Li told a press conference.
Li also encouraged more funds and services from society at large to take part in social assistance work.
